编程中国 | 业界新闻 | 技术文章 | 视频教程 | 下载频道 | 程序源码 | 个人空间 | 编程论坛  
全能 ASP / PHP / ASP.NET 主机,支持月付专业 MSSQL 数据库空间,支持月付专业 MySQL 数据库空间,支持月付学习型 ASP/PHP/ASP.NET 主机 30元/年
发新话题
打印

delphi中连接帮助文件

delphi中连接帮助文件

本人自学delphi,遇到一问题.希望有高手可以解答:如何在一个程序或软件中链接一个帮助文件,运行程序是点击"帮助文件"在窗口外打开帮助文件

TOP

procedure TForm1.N13Click(Sender: TObject); var HWndHelp:Hwnd; i:integer; begin

//检查帮助窗口是否已经存在

HWndHelp:=FindWindow(nil,'系统帮助文件');

if HwndHelp<>0 then // 如存在则关闭

SendMessage(HwndHelp,WM_CLOSE,0,0);

i:=ShellExecute(handle, 'open',Pchar('\help.chm'),nil, nil, sw_ShowNormal);

end; 以上适用于打开文件名为*.chm后缀的帮助文件,此处仅以help.chm举例说明,请把帮助文件放在可执行文件的根目录

TOP

发新话题